#265283 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#265283 is composed of 14.9% red, 32.2%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71% cyan, 37.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 211.6 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 33.1%. #265283 color hex could be obtained by blending #4ca4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#265283 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#265283 has RGB values of R:38, G:82,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 2511491.

Shades and Tints of #265283
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030609 is the darkest color, while #f9f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#265283
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545456 is the less saturated color, while #0650a4 is the most saturated one.
